Macadamia/Family
Macadamia Nut. The family Proteaceae includes approximately 10 species of the genus Macadamia, two of which produce edible nuts: Macadamia integrifolia and Macadamia tetraphylla or hybrids of these.

What did macadamia nuts used to be called?

Other names include Queensland nut, bush nut, maroochi nut, bauple nut and Hawaii nut. In Australian Aboriginal languages, the fruit is known by names such as bauple, gyndl, jindilli and boombera. It was an important source of bushfood for the Aboriginal peoples who are the original inhabitants of the area.

Why is macadamia nuts so expensive?

But why are macadamia nuts so expensive? The main reason is the slow harvesting process. While there are ten species of macadamia trees, only 2 produce the pricey nuts and it takes seven to 10 years for the trees to even begin producing nuts. They’re only harvested five to six times a year, typically by hand.

Do macadamia nuts cause weight gain?

5. They may prevent weight gain. Macadamia nuts and their oil are some of the richest sources of palmitoleic acid, a monounsaturated fat also called omega-7. Researchers in one study gave sheep palmitoleic acid for 28 days, and the results show a reduction in weight gain by 77 percent.

    Where are the seeds of the macadamia tree?

    Macadamia nut is the seed of the macadamia tree. Macadamia nuts are native to Australia. They are grown commercially in Hawaii and, to a much smaller extent, in California and Florida.
